Qualcomm Snapdragon 412 or Intel Core i7-6820EQ -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.

The Qualcomm Snapdragon 412 has 4 cores with 4 threads and clocks with a maximum frequency of 1.40 GHz. Up to 4 GB of memory is supported in 1 memory channels. The Qualcomm Snapdragon 412 was released in Q3/2015.

The Intel Core i7-6820EQ has 4 cores with 8 threads and clocks with a maximum frequency of 3.50 GHz. The CPU supports up to 64 GB of memory in 2 memory channels. The Intel Core i7-6820EQ was released in Q4/2015.

CPU Cores and Base Frequency

The Qualcomm Snapdragon 412 is a 4 core processor with a clock frequency of 1.40 GHz. The Intel Core i7-6820EQ has 4 CPU cores with a clock frequency of 2.80 GHz (3.50 GHz).

Memory & PCIe

The Qualcomm Snapdragon 412 supports a maximum of 4 GB of memory in 1 memory channels. The Intel Core i7-6820EQ can connect up to 64 GB of memory in 2 memory channels.
